7 Summer St

 

 We officially acquired our first property in the summer of 2022. This project, funded by the City of Somerville, the Somerville Affordable Housing Trust Fund, and Winter Hill Bank, brings five permanently affordable homes to Somerville’s Union Square Neighborhood. The newly constructed condominium building sits atop land that will be stewarded in perpetuity by the Somerville Community Land Trust.

In spring of 2023, we welcomed our first five families! We are working hard to acquire our next property and continue making progress toward our goal of providing affordable homeownership opportunities to low- and moderate-income Somerville residents.

 

12 Pleasant Ave

Acquired in January 2024, this multifamily rental building includes six 2-bedroom apartments that were already home to six households. We are thrilled to share tenancies have been preserved!  

The City of Somerville Office of Housing Stability provided financial support to the Community Action Agency of Somerville (CAAS)  to unionize tenants at 12 Pleasant Ave. after tenants informed CAAS that the property was to be sold. With support from CAAS, tenants successfully remained in their homes while the SCLT coordinated with the City of Somerville Housing Division to secure financing through the Affordable Housing Trust Fund and purchase the building. 297 Medford Street

Somerville CLT is in the process of acquiring 297 Medford Street in partnership with Just A Start to construct a 100% affordable rental development with ~50 new apartments in the Gilman Square neighborhood of Somerville by leveraging the City of Somerville’s Affordable Housing Overlay. We have an entered into a Purchase & Sale Agreement with the sellers and are currently in an environmental due diligence phase due to the site’s prior use as an auto-body shop that partially collapsed and was demolished in 2021. SCLT and Just A Start must seek a zoning map amendment to change the site’s designation from Mid-Rise 3 to Mid-Rise 4 to bring this project at a scale large enough to move the project forward. At the current zoning, financial limitations prevent the site from hosting a affordable housing development.
